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ions:
b3log Symphony (aka Sym) version 2.6.0
Description:
The issue allows remote attackers to upload and execute arbitrary JSP files. This is achieved via the
name[] parameter to the "/upload" URI.Recommendations:
For version 2.6.0, consider restricting access to the /upload URI to prevent arbitrary JSP file uploads until a patch is available. As a temporary workaround, avoid using the
name[] parameter in the affected /upload URI to minimize the risk of exploitation.Exploit
